The Rocky Ford Solar Energy Center is a proposed 90 MW solar generation project located in Henry County, Virginia. The project, developed by AEP, is interconnected within the PJM Interconnection queue as entry AE2-166, filed on March 16, 2019. The proposed commercial operation date is December 31, 2026, and the interconnection agreement has been executed. The point of interconnection is the Stockton 138 kV line.
The Rocky Ford Solar Energy Center development has been the subject of recent news coverage, with eight articles appearing in industry publications. The project's status is currently listed as suspended.
